Base Salary
The initial rate of compensation that an employee receives in exchange for services, excluding extra payments like bonuses or commissions.
Behavioral Economics
A field of economic research that examines psychological, cognitive, emotional, cultural, and social factors on economic decisions.
Loss Aversion
A principle in behavioral economics stating that individuals tend to prefer avoiding losses to acquiring equivalent gains.
Price Increase
A rise in the cost of goods or services over time, often measured as a percentage.
